1. Spring Cloud Netflix Spring Cloud Netflix 是Spring Cloud 的核心子項目,是對Netflix公司一系列開源產品的封裝。它為Spring Boot應用提供了自動配置的整合,只需要通過一些簡單的注解,就可以快速的在Spring Cloud ...
. 引入依賴 在前面幾節中的消費者中添加pom依賴。 . 在啟動類上添加注解 添加 EnableHystrixDashboard 開啟Dashboard。 . 注冊HystrixMetricsStreamServlet 在 .x之前的版本中,會自動注入該Servlet的,但是在 .x之后的版本,沒有自動注冊該Servlet。看源碼的解釋。 所以這里需要我們手動的注冊該Servlet到容器中,代碼 ...
2019-05-10 14:26 0 709 推薦指數:
1. Spring Cloud Netflix Spring Cloud Netflix 是Spring Cloud 的核心子項目,是對Netflix公司一系列開源產品的封裝。它為Spring Boot應用提供了自動配置的整合,只需要通過一些簡單的注解,就可以快速的在Spring Cloud ...
1. Spring Cloud Netflix Spring Cloud Netflix 是Spring Cloud 的核心子項目,是對Netflix公司一系列開源產品的封裝。它為Spring Boot應用提供了自動配置的整合,只需要通過一些簡單的注解,就可以快速的在Spring Cloud ...
上期spring-cloud-consumer-hystrix工程進行修改,添加hystrix Dashboard功能 添加所需要的依賴: ...
ystrix除了隔離依賴服務的調用以外,Hystrix 還提供了准實時的調用監控(Hystrix Dashboard),Hystrix 會持續地記錄所有通過 Hystrix 發起的請求的執行信息,並以統計報表和圖形的形式展示給用戶,包括每秒執行多少請求多少成功,多少失敗等。 下面我們基於之前 ...
前面我們搭建了具有服務降級功能的Hystrix客戶端,現在我們來詳細了解下Hystrix的一些功能。 Hystrix的意思是豪豬,大家都知道,就是長滿刺的豬。。。實際上,它表明了該框架的主要功能:自我保護功能。Hystrix具有服務降級,熔斷,線程池隔離,信號量隔離,緩存等功能,基本上能覆蓋 ...
4 Spring Cloud Netflix Spring Cloud 通過自動配置和綁定到Spring環境和其他Spring編程模型慣例,為Spring Boot應用程序提供Netflix OSS集成。 通過幾個簡單的注釋,可以快速啟用和配置應用程序中的常見功能模塊,並使用久經考驗 ...
較低級別的服務中的服務故障可能導致級聯故障一直到用戶。 當對特定服務的調用超過circuitBreaker.requestVolumeThreshold(默認值:20個請求)且失敗百分比大於ci ...
Hystrix除了可以對不可用的服務進行斷路隔離外,還能夠對服務進行實時監控。Hystrix可以實時、累加地記錄所有關於HystrixCommand的執行信息,包括每秒執行多少、請求成功多少、失敗多少等。 要想實時地對服務進行監控,需要在項目中添加相關的監控依賴,具體 ...